The Sikkim Manipal University was established in 1995. It is the first government-private initiative in the region. SMU is recognized by the University Grants Commission and approved by the Govern- ment of India. Sikkim Manipal University offers quality education to the students from North and North Eastern parts of India.

The National Policy of Education (NPE) 1986, emphasized that distance education is an important medium for the development and promotion of higher education. In this context, for the expansion and promotion of distance education the Central Advisory Board of Education (CABE), Government of India took an important decision that in the VIIIth year plan every state should establish a state open university following the distance education pattern.
